Problem converting (migrating) project from Visual Studio 2003 to Visual Studio 2005

I want to migrate VS2003 Windows/Class library/console project to VS2005 Windows/Class library/console project. And the DLL out of VS2005 project should work as previously.

Note: My main project contains some other 3-4 projects (Class libraries, Windows Application) in it.

What I tried is -
1. Conversion of VS2003 project to VS2005 project through VS2005 editor.
2. Compiled the VS2003 project under VS2005 editor with no errors.
3. I have tried to use the DLL out of step 2, but now it’s not working properly.

Note: Previous version of DLL (VS2003 version) is working fine for me.

Could anybody please help me out in this?
